Radish seedling planting method and time cultivation steps (technical points)

Suitable time for planting radish seedlings

Radish seedlings are generally sown from February to April each year. If sown in summer, they are sown from May to June, and in autumn and winter, they are sown from August to October. They grow very fast, and it only takes about 7-10 days from sowing to picking and eating.

Radish seedling planting methods and key points

1. Land preparation and fertilization

When planting radish seedlings, you must first prepare the land and apply fertilizer to ensure that the soil is deep, fertile and loose. The specific method should be determined according to the specific situation. If you are planting small or medium-sized radishes, you should use flat beds for cultivation. If you are planting large radishes, you should use high beds for cultivation.

2. Planting

The planting method of radish seedlings is very simple. Choose radish seedlings with good growth, dig holes and plant them directly. Be careful not to plant them too densely, otherwise they will easily grow too tall and reduce the yield. Do not damage the roots during transplanting, and keep the roots moist.

Key points for managing radish seedlings

After planting the radish seedlings, you need to water them in time, in small amounts and multiple times, and make sure to water them thoroughly. The seedlings also need to be shaded. The transplanted seedlings will resume growth in 2-3 days. With normal management, they can be exposed to the sun and ventilation appropriately, but not in direct sunlight to avoid sunburn.
